Mark your calendars for the 17th Annual 5k for K9s benefitting local non-profit, Friends of the Shelter! The event will be held on Saturday, 9/27/25 at 9:00am at Alum Creek State Park. You'll love the 5K run/walk along the beach, through the woods and across the dam! The run/walk kicks off at 9 a.m., with registration beginning at 8 a.m.
All proceeds benefit Friends of the Shelter, helping sick and injured dogs at the Franklin County Dog Shelter and Adoption Center in Columbus, Ohio.
